- English translation of the author's Les aventures de Télémaque.
- Contents:
- v. 1. Preface to the last French Paris edition ; Advertisement about this English version / A. Boyer ; An allusion to the Bishop of Cambray's Telemachus. In imitation of Homer : written in the year 1707 / by the late Duke of Devonshire. A discourse upon epick poetry, and the excellence of the poem of Telemachus / [by A.M. Ramsay] ; The adventures of Telemachus : books I-XII
- v. 2. The adventures of Telemachus : books XIII-XXIV ; The adventures of Aristonous.
- Notes:
- Signatures: volume 1: A¹² a⁶ B-N¹² O¹²(-O12) ; volume 2: pi1 A-M¹².
- Pagination: volume 1: xxxvi, 309, [1] pages, [1] leaf of plates ; volume 2: [2], 264, [3], 468-487, [1] pages.
- Engraved frontispiece plate (portrait).
- Woodcut initial, factotums, head- and tail-pieces.
- Type ornament factotums, head-pieces and tail-piece.
- Title of volume 1 in red and black.
